我一直在尝试使用以下代码将我的资源中的图像加载到使用C#的 Visual Studio 2012上的图片框。
pictureBox1.Load(Properties.Resources.Desert);
我遇到了以下错误。
System.Windows.Forms.PictureBox.Load(string)
的最佳重载方法匹配包含一些无效参数System.Drawing.Bitmap
转换为string
答案 0 :(得分:1)
Load
方法需要string
。你直接传递了一个Bitmap
的资源..这是行不通的。
试试这个:
pictureBox1.Image = Properties.Resources.Desert;
这会直接将PictureBox
中的图片设置为资源中的Bitmap
。